The Texas Girls’ State Fair began in 2005 and became a growing tradition for The Women’s Museum and girls in Texas. The Texas Girls' State Fair is a program to honor, recognize and showcase the achievements and interests of Texas girls from ages 10-18 in this spectacular and unique revue. Each girl chosen will have the opportunity to show her talent at The Women’s Museum during the State Fair of Texas.

Three girls will be chosen to receive a $500 Education Award. Check out the 2009 finalistshere.
